Programme Overview
The Postgraduate Certificate in Material Fatigue and Fracture Mechanics is tailored for engineers, researchers, and professionals who seek to enhance their expertise in the intricate fields of materials science, particularly in fatigue and fracture mechanics. This programme delves into advanced analytical techniques, experimental methods, and computational tools to understand material behavior under cyclic and static loading. Learners will explore the fundamental principles governing the initiation and propagation of cracks in materials, with a focus on developing a comprehensive understanding of fracture mechanics theories and their practical applications.
Throughout the programme, learners will develop critical skills in experimental design, data analysis, and the use of finite element analysis (FEA) software. They will gain proficiency in interpreting material properties and failure mechanisms, enabling them to predict and mitigate potential failures in engineering structures and components. The curriculum also emphasizes the integration of these theoretical and practical skills into real-world engineering problems, preparing participants to play a pivotal role in enhancing the safety and durability of mechanical systems.

Topics Covered
- Fundamentals of Material Science: Covers the basic properties and behaviors of materials.: Mechanics of Materials: Discusses stress, strain, and deformation in materials.
- Fatigue Fundamentals: Introduces the basics of cyclic loading and fatigue life prediction.: Fracture Mechanics: Explores the principles of crack propagation and fracture.
- Experimental Techniques: Teaches methods for testing and analyzing material properties.: Case Studies: Analyzes real-world applications of fatigue and fracture mechanics.
